Best Wishes is a WIP romance-adventure visual novel about a young, hot-blooded elf attempting to get her crush a present in the wake of his oncoming birthday. Unfortunately, Kree is an idiot, so this may (definitely) be far, far harder than she expected it to be.

Synopsis


In the mountainous nation of Fyrholde, strength is respected above all else, and no pursuit held in more esteem than that of glorious battle. The long nights and brutal winters foster close-knit communities, and such is true of Astrid's Oathbound, a unit of warriors who share a feasting hall affectionately known as Attyrhus. Their work is, on the whole, simple - Fyrholde is filled with threats ranging from dragons to petty bandits, and for a fee, Astrid's Oathbound will... eliminate problems. Violently.

It's not a glamorous life, or a particularly easy one, but they all seem happy enough.

Of course, not every day can involve conquering a beastly foe, though today certainly feels like that for Kree, a young elf from the southern Sylphlands who has, through mysterious circumstances, come to make Attyrhus her home.

Kree is good at many things. Screaming a lot! Brewing potions! Fighting bears! But when she learns that tomorrow is the birthday of the man she's secretly in love with, Kree finds herself honor bound to acquire a present and celebrate his existence in the Fyrish tradition... which is something that's much more easily said than done, given that Kree's skillset basically ends at scholastic dismemberment.

Not that she'd ever let that stop her. Kree is, if nothing else, determined, which may very well land in more trouble than she bargained for.

Characters


Kree
Image
Our delightful protagonist. She very obviously is foreign to Fyrholde, but she refuses to be shamed about anything regarding her character and prefers punching things to talking about the odd circumstances that landed her there in the first place. She squanders away her profound wizardly talent by using it to make herself really, really good at fistfights, and while most people see this as cheating, it's hard to chastise someone who's decked a bear. She's very desperately in love with Folke, and considers him a dear friend. It doesn't matter if her affections are forever unrequited. Seeing him happy is all she can really ask for in life.

Underneath her brash exterior, she's a very inquisitive, thoughtful, curious person.

Folke
Image
The birthday boy! Well, almost. Folke is Attyrhus' blacksmith, though he's insecure about his abilities, seeing himself as a meager replacement for his fabulously talented (but ultimately deadbeat) dad. Not that he'd let that show! He's the pinnacle of reliability and he's fabulously kind, which is a good part of the reason Kree has fallen head-over-heels for him. It helps that he's remarkably patient and lets her babble about whatever latest curiosity has taken her fancy.

He doesn't particularly care much that it's his birthday tomorrow. Kree takes this to mean that she needs to go 200% in caring for him.

Briar
Image
Briar was born in the south, explaining the comparative strangeness of her name. She's a ward of Ranveig, the honorary leader of Astrid's Oathbound, who came into his company after a traumatic incident that left her sans a pair of hands. She's since acquired a pair of replacements constructed from salvaged dwarven technology, magic, and medieval hot-glue, which she has used to become very, very good at making sure nothing ever gets near her hands again.

Vis a vis stabbing.

Her most notable traits are her even temper and regal demeanor. Briar looks the part of a holy paladin, and boy howdy, does she hate the forces of darkness. While Kree doesn't care much one way or another about demons, zombies, and necromancers, she thinks Briar is pretty gosh-darn cool and will gladly follow her into battle. Today, she's going on a trip to a dwarven ruin to find replacement parts for her hands. This may or may not get bungled up by Kree.

Ulfr
Image
Succinctly put, Ulfr is a jerk. A big, massive, I don't like you because you're different from me jerk. He and Kree have a very tense relationship that started when his first words to her were an insult about her height, and her response was to introduce her fist to his face. He's also one of those 'charge in and think later' types, which should endear Kree to him at least a little bit, but he also seems to think books are the work of the devil so, y'know.

Not really on great terms with the local wizard, even though Kree isn't a particularly... austere one.

He can, occasionally, be kind of nice, particularly when it comes to Folke, a man he holds in pretty high regard. That might be why he's amenable to the idea of helping Kree pick out a present in keeping with Fyrish tradition. Whether or not Kree accepts, and whether or not they can refrain from trying to kill each other for two seconds is... up in the air.

Features
  • * Roughly 150k wordcount for the full game (there's lots of branching). Demo includes ~32k words.
    * Numerous, indepth ways to die and fail horribly, usually accompanied by a quasi-divine entity making fun of you. The demo includes one good ending, 3 was to die, and one "to be continued" ending.
    * Discover hidden truths about the world and the characters inhabiting it by gathering information between multiple paths.
    * Three distinct adventures, one focused on dungeoneering, one focused on domestic mishaps, and one exploring just how horribly wrong a shopping trip can go, all with multiple branching paths within them.
    * Plenty of poorly picked fights full of improvisational combat and bad decisions
    * Spooky stuff involving dwarves that might not actually be dwarves
    * Dogs.

That impression might change if you play the demo! It's not really a bright comedy, so to speak - and I think it shows in some parts that horror is my favorite genre. Pretty serious topics like slavery and war are also discussed, and
Ulfr bears Kree a lot of ill-will due to war crimes committed by the elves in the not-too-distant past.
Overall, I'd say Best Wishes has a dark comedy flair to it, which is why I picked the limited color palette - along with it dealing primarily with what basically amounts to fantasy vikings. (Also, the limited color palette does have some thematic meaning.)

I'm glad the premise intrigues you, though, especially since you've consumed so much fantasy work to judge it against! If you like detailed fantasy, I have tried to put a lot of thought into this world... and I've also tried to play with classical fantasy stereotypes in an atypical way. Elves, for example, are highly nationalistic, dwarves seem to have turned math into a religion, and the cosmological system is rooted (hahaha) in the belief that the world came from a divine tree. The world is, in a lot of ways, strange... and a priority of mine is making sure it has character.
